Transaction 592cf1fd81e70a659cb85b9337e17d0e95ee253fae46cd776095085ca1923907
1 Input
1 Output
-
592cf1fd81e70a659cb85b9337e17d0e95ee253fae46cd776095085ca1923907:0
- value
- 7243739
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7362b347e22314660f695a995c41de6201f54695 OP_EQUAL
- address
- 3CD7sRTE6RgeMjkqv4zbgM3DU8f2MnPYps